篇名 INDUCTION OF NITROGEN FIXING (ACETYLENE REDUCTION) ACTIVITY OF RHIZOBIA GROWING SYMBIOTICALLY AND ASYMBIOTICALLY WITH SOYBEAN CALLUS TISSUES

The rhizobium-soybean callus association in both symbiotic or asymbiolic system caused the R. japonicum to establish an acetylene reduction (nitrogen fixation) system. The symbiosis between rhizobium and callus was not an obligativc requirement for the induction of nitro-genasc synthesis in rhizobia. However, some unknown critical substance(s) produced by the callus is required to initiate the nitrogenasc synthesis in the rhizobium. The rhizobia in the symbiotic rhizobium-callus system had 10* times higher nitrogen fixing activity than those in the asymbiotic system. The development of nitrogenasc in rhizobium in both systems, unlike in intact plant, was not inhibited by the presence of combined nitrogen in medium. The nitrogen fixation might not be interferred by the nitrate assimilatory processes. The callus could regulate the nitrogen fixing activity of rhizobia but the level of rhizobial nitrogen fixation could not delay the senescence of callus tissues. The rhizobial nitrogen fixing activity declined at the time of callus tissues senesced.
